    	* tools/pdbgen/pdb/brushes.pdb: Big Brushes Cleanup.
    
    	The GimpBrush* object hierarchy and the file formats were broken by
    	"design". This made it overly difficult to read and write pixmap
    	brushes and brush pipes, leading to the situation that The GIMP was
    	not able to read it's very own file formats. Since the GimpBrush
    	format did support arbitrary color depths, the introduction of a
    	file format for pixmap brushes was unnecessary.
    
    	The GimpBrushPixmap object is dead. GimpBrush has an additional
    	pixmap temp_buf and handles pixmap brushes transparently. The file
    	format of pixmap brushes is not any longer a grayscale brush plus
    	a pattern, but a simple brush with RGBA data. The old brushes can
    	still be loaded, but the .gpb format is deprecated.
    
    	GimpBrushPipe derives from GimpBrush. The fileformat is still a text
    	header, followed by a number of brushes, but those brushes are stored
    	in the new GimpBrush format (no pattern anymore). The pipe does not
    	care about the depth of the contained GimpBrushes, so we get
    	grayscale BrushPipes for free. Since the brush loader still loads the
    	old format, old .gih files can also still be loaded.
    
    	Since the brushes in the GimpBrushPipe do not any longer contain a
    	pointer to the pipe object, we do only temporarily switch brushes
    	in the paint_core routines. This is not very elegant, but the best
    	we can do without a major redesign.
